欧美精品在线第一页,久久av影院,午夜视频在线播放一三,久久91精品久久久久久秒播,成人一区三区,久久综合狠狠综合久久狠狠色综合,成人av一区二区亚洲精,欧美a级在线观看

Feature: Belgian coder behind popular Go software Leela

Source: Xinhua| 2018-02-04 04:47:34|Editor: yan
Video PlayerClose

by Xinhua writer Wang Zichen

BRUSSELS, Feb. 3 (Xinhua) -- A Belgian programmer behind Leela, a computer Go software that surprised many East Asian players with its strength, turned out to be not a Go enthusiast and last played the game more than a decade ago.

Gian-Carlo Pascutto, a 35-year-old electronics engineer whose day job is to work for Mozilla on the Internet browser Firefox, only played Go actively for half a year as a student in the city of Ghent at the age of 19, he said in an interview with Xinhua on Saturday.

Go, considered one of the four essential arts of the cultured aristocratic Chinese scholars in antiquity, is an abstract strategy board game for two players, invented in ancient China and believed to be the oldest board game continuously played today.

Pascutto, born and living in Ninove, roughly halfway between Brussels and Ghent, was more interested in chess and developed Sjeng, a software that repeatedly won global computer chess championships.

That experience, he said, helped him with developing Leela, which was quite strong compared to other Go software programs at the time.

Leela was first published in 2007, and Pascutto took it into the Computer Olympiad in China next year, where Leela won a silver and a bronze.

INSPIRATION FROM ALPHAGO

To be sure, Go software programs back then were still miles away from winning a game with the professional human players, until the emergence of AlphaGo, which crashed the best human players and rekindled global interest in the game,

Developed by Alphabet Inc.'s Google DeepMind, AlphaGo in 2015 became the first to beat a human professional player and later beat the world champions.

By that time, Pascutto had stopped working on Leela for quite some time.

"Because of AlphaGo there is a lot of publicity of Go," he said, "I read the paper (describing the algorithms used), considered what was applicable to Leela and implemented them."

"Very big improvement" in Leela was clear, Pascutto said, thanks to inspiration from the AlphaGo paper as well as "all the things that have improved in the computers during the years".

EASY USE

The much stronger Leela caught eyes in East Asia, where ordinary players -- those play Go not as a profession but as a pastime -- praise it to be particularly good in early stages of a game.

Besides, Leela's easy access and good performance on inexpensive hardware are widely applauded.

Many other Go software programs are difficult to use on a Windows operating system, or require expensive processing chips to run on, but Leela performs at a reasonably strong level on a personal computer, Zhou Yang, a Chinese player wrote on an online Go forum.

Despite not speaking Chinese, Japanese or Korean, Pascutto said he was aware of the comments of his work over the Internet, sometimes with the help of Google Translate.

"Many people try to send me an email (saying) like I found a position where Leela should go," Pascutto said, "(but) you cannot really improve the program on single position. If you improve one thing, it gets worse somewhere else."

"It's a big difference between explaining to a human player how to do it, and (explaining to) a computer how to do it," Pascutto said, which may also explain why Leela is strong but he himself doesn't really play Go very well.

ONE-MAN'S HOBBY

The latest Leela, featuring deep learning technology, has a "neural network" trained with more than 32 million positions from high-level Go games and taught to predict which moves a professional human player would most likely consider.

It's one-man's work for about two years, Pascutto said, when he spent around one and a half hours each evening.

"I enjoy it," he said, in developing Leela, "I learn new things. I have to learn all the things about how deep learning works."

There are fifteen thousand lines of code behind Leela, Pascutto said, and "if you have fast enough computer, it's about professional level. I'm satisfied with it now".

There are calls to translate Leela into other languages, and Pascutto thought about making a version for mobile phones.

"But this is for me a hobby, I need to find time," the father-of-two said.

For Go players, the good news is that Pascutto is still working on a related program.

AlphaGo's team published an article in the journal Nature in October 2017, introducing AlphaGo Zero, a version without human data and stronger than any previous human-champion-defeating version.

"Right now I'm working on Leela Zero," which has no human-provided knowledge and is modeled after the AlphaGo Zero paper, Pascutto said.

TOP STORIES
EDITOR’S CHOICE
MOST VIEWED
EXPLORE XINHUANET
010020070750000000000000011105521369471221
主站蜘蛛池模板: 真实的国产乱xxxx在线91| 久久99精品久久久久国产越南| 日本一二三四区视频| 亚洲精品日日夜夜| 久久久久国产精品视频| 日本一二三区视频| 91精品国产影片一区二区三区| 日韩精品少妇一区二区在线看| 91精品美女| 午夜av电影网| 日韩精品午夜视频| 亚洲福利视频二区| 91精品综合| 91久久免费| 亚洲精品乱码久久久久久写真| 91精品久久久久久| 一区二区欧美精品| 欧美资源一区| 亚洲国产一区二区精华液| 国产一区二区麻豆| 96国产精品| 国产三级精品在线观看| 日本精品99| 一区二区在线视频免费观看| 国产日韩一二三区| 国产一区二区片| 96精品国产| 三级电影中文| 国产在线一区二区视频| 国产97久久| 高清国产一区二区三区| 欧美网站一区二区三区| 午夜肉伦伦影院九七影网| 免费观看又色又爽又刺激的视频| 国产精品九九九九九九| 97久久精品一区二区三区观看| 欧美hdxxxx| 亚洲精品97久久久babes| 久99久视频| 亚洲精品日韩激情欧美| 久久国产精品网站| 人人玩人人添人人澡97| 国产大学生呻吟对白精彩在线| 久久久99精品国产一区二区三区| 国产精品视频二区不卡| 欧美片一区二区| 亚洲理论影院| 97久久精品一区二区三区观看| 狠狠色噜噜狠狠狠狠88| 农村妇女精品一二区| 午夜一级免费电影| 欧美国产亚洲精品| 亚洲国产精品网站| 国产精品伦一区二区三区在线观看 | 欧美一区二区三区性| 伊人av中文av狼人av| 日韩a一级欧美一级在线播放| 性精品18videosex欧美| 97人人模人人爽人人喊0| 国产99视频精品免视看芒果| 国产欧美一区二区三区免费看| 在线精品一区二区| 日韩在线一区视频| 国产欧美精品一区二区三区-老狼 国产精品一二三区视频网站 | 色偷偷一区二区三区| av毛片精品| 999久久久国产精品| 国产足控福利视频一区| 亚洲欧美日韩国产综合精品二区| 午夜激情电影在线播放| 国产一区二区视频在线| 国产足控福利视频一区| 99久久夜色精品国产网站| 国产麻豆精品久久| 国产午夜亚洲精品午夜鲁丝片| 欧美极品少妇xxxxⅹ| 91丝袜国产在线观看| 日韩中文字幕在线一区| 午夜国产一区二区| 国产午夜精品一区二区三区四区 | 欧美一区二区三区久久精品视| 日韩不卡毛片|